What is software development?
Software development is the process of creating, designing, and coding computer programs or applications that can be used on different devices such as computers, smartphones, or tablets. It involves writing instructions or code that tells the computer what to do and how to behave.
What is software architecture?
Software architecture is like the blueprint or plan for building a house. It defines the overall structure and organization of a software system, including how different components or parts of the system will interact with each other. It helps ensure that the software is designed and built in a way that makes it scalable, maintainable, and efficient.
Why is software development important?
Software development is important because it allows people to create and build useful computer programs and applications that solve problems or provide valuable services. It enables the development of technology that we use in our daily lives, such as social media platforms, mobile apps, video games, and many others.
How do software developers write code?
Software developers write code using programming languages such as Java, Python, C++, or JavaScript. These languages are like a special set of instructions that computers can understand. Developers use these languages to write the instructions that tell the computer what to do, step by step.
What is the difference between frontend and backend development?
Frontend development is focused on creating the parts of a software application that users interact with directly, such as the user interface and design. It involves working with programming languages like HTML, CSS, and JavaScript to build web pages or mobile app screens.
Backend development, on the other hand, focuses on building the behind-the-scenes functionality of a software application. It involves working with databases, servers, and programming languages like PHP, Ruby, or Python, to ensure that the application can process and store data, and perform tasks requested by the user.
What is a programming language?
A programming language is like a set of rules or instructions that software developers use to tell computers what to do. It's a way of communicating with the computer and giving it specific commands. Each programming language has its own syntax and rules that developers need to follow to write code correctly. Examples of programming languages include Java, Python, C++, and JavaScript.